AHCC Immune Support: Benefits, Dosage & Uses

Kinoko Gold AHCC is a natural supplement made primarily from shiitake mushroom extract which is fermented, filtered and dried to produce a powdered supplement.

AHCC stands for Active Hexose Correlated Compound. The active compound in AHCC is alpha-glucans, which is unique to AHCC and thought to be key to its immune supporting effects.

How Genetics Affect Nutrient Absorption & Immunity

The immune system is the body’s natural defense against infections, and its function can be influenced by many factors, including diet, genetics, and nutrient levels. While there is no single food or supplement that can provide a "magic boost" to the immune system, optimising nutrient intake is essential for supporting immune health. Nutrients like vitamins A, C, D, folate, iron, and zinc are key to maintaining strong immune responses, and genetic factors can influence how well your body absorbs and utilises these nutrients.

Do Your Genes Increase Inflammation Risk?

Inflammation is the body's natural defence mechanism against injury and infection, a process that typically promotes healing. However, when inflammation persists and becomes chronic, it can trigger a range of serious health issues, including autoimmune diseases, cardiovascular problems, and metabolic disorders. While factors such as diet, stress, and environmental toxins significantly influence inflammation levels, genetics also plays a crucial role in determining your susceptibility to inflammatory conditions.
